Seriously though, two people in my residency program had two young children. One of them delivered her second not long before boards her third year. You just have to plan ahead and know how to budget your time. Family time is around dinner. After bedtime is study and work time.

You'll navigate it as you figure out how quickly you pick up the outside of work material.
 
I know a two-surgeon household with the female being a resident. She had a child this past year (her 2nd) and still kicks ass/has highest inservice scores. People try to make things seem harder than they are. If you want it, you will figure it out.
